Which is cheaper, Governors State University or University of Illinois Springfield?

University of Illinois Springfield, at $9,833 a year after aid versus $12,329 — a gap of $2,496 a year, or $9,984 across the full degree. These are net prices after grants and scholarships, not sticker prices, so they reflect what an aided student pays.

Do Governors State University or University of Illinois Springfield graduates earn more?

Governors State University graduates report a median $58,169 ten years after entry, $1,066 more than the $57,103 at University of Illinois Springfield. Both are institution-wide medians from federal tax records, so a high-paying major at the lower school can beat the average at the higher one.

Which leaves students with less debt, Governors State University or University of Illinois Springfield?

Governors State University: its completers carry a median $18,618 in federal loans versus $19,128 at University of Illinois Springfield, a difference of $510. The figure counts students who finished; it excludes private loans and anyone who left before graduating.

Which graduates more of its students?

53% of students finish at University of Illinois Springfield, against 22% at Governors State University. Completion matters to the ROI arithmetic because a degree that is never finished still carries its cost and its debt, but earns none of the graduate premium above the $48,360 high-school baseline.
